Top Roof Solutions: Kinds of Materials and Their Advantages
Roofing products serve an important role in the overall performance and longevity of a home. Various types of roofing materials are available, each offering unique benefits tailored to specific needs. Asphalt shingles are widely used for their affordability and ease of installation, providing consistent protection against the elements. Metal roofing is recognized for its durability and energy efficiency, often outperforming traditional materials. Clay and concrete tiles grant a distinctive aesthetic and excellent thermal performance, making them suitable for warmer climates.
Wood shingles and shakes, while requiring more servicing, provide a natural look and strong insulation. Additionally, engineered materials, such as rubber or composite options, merge the appearance of time-honored choices with advanced durability and lower maintenance requirements. Each material delivers separate perks, permitting homeowners to decide based on expenditure, climate, and aesthetic goals, ultimately adding to the residence's structural integrity and financial value.

Recognizing Frequent Roofing Problems and Their Solutions
Typical roof problems can seriously affect the soundness of a home. Among the commonly faced issues are leaks caused by damaged shingles, improper flashing, or failing sealants. Detecting these leaks promptly is important as they might cause major water damage if left untreated. Moreover, the presence of moss and algae is another typical problem that can undermine the roof's materials and appearance. Routine cleaning of the surface is effective in managing this challenge.
Additionally, cracked or missing shingles reflect damage, often necessitating replacement to ensure protection against the elements. Poor ventilation can cause overheating, leading to early degradation of roofing materials. Homeowners are encouraged to undertake regular inspections and work with professional roofers for customized fixes for specific issues. Timely identification and resolution of these common problems can considerably lengthen a roof's lifespan and protect the home's overall structure.

Regular Inspections Matter
Regular inspections play an essential role in extending the lifespan of a roof. By recognizing potential issues early, homeowners can prevent small problems from escalating major damage. A detailed inspection usually covers looking for missing shingles, evaluating flashing durability, and examining gutters for debris accumulation. Such evaluations allow for timely interventions, guaranteeing the roof stays watertight and structurally sound. Moreover, seasonal inspections help in modifying maintenance strategies depending on fluctuating weather conditions, which may influence roof performance. Creating a regular inspection routine, ideally twice annually, allows homeowners to remain proactive about roof upkeep. This diligence not only improves the roof's durability but also contributes to the overall value of the property, making it a sound investment.

Popular Asked Questions
What Duration Should You Expect for a Standard Roofing Project?
A traditional roofing project usually takes 1-2 weeks to complete, controlled by various factors such as the scope of the roof, kind of material, seasonal conditions, and any unforeseen complications that may manifest during the execution.
Which Warranties Are Available for Roofing Projects?
Roofing service warranties typically feature workmanship warranties spanning one to ten years and material warranties extending to 50 years. The specifics often copyright on the roofing materials used and the service provider's guidelines.
Which Permits are Required for Roof Work?
Yes, a license is often required for roofing work, based on local codes and the scope of the project. Homeowners should consult their municipal offices to ensure adherence with required building codes and licenses.
How Do I Prepare My Home for Roofing Installation?
Preparing a home ready for roof work, you should clear the area around the house, remove outdoor furniture, place pets inside for safety, and make sure easy access to the roof for workers and materials.
